As it's possible you'll previously know, most passwords are saved hashed with the builders of the favorites Sites. It means they don’t preserve the password you chose inside a plain textual content variety, they change it into A further benefit, a illustration of the password. But in the procedure, can two passwords provide the very same hash representation? That’s…
The result results in being the new initialization vector B for the 3rd Procedure. The values for B, C and D are rotated to the ideal, to make sure that B will become the initialization vector C, C turns into the initialization vector D, and D results in being the initialization vector A.
Though MD5 was after common, it is no more deemed a secure option for cryptographic needs in right now’s cybersecurity landscape.
Checksums: Quite a few software package deals and downloads supply an MD5 checksum for customers to validate the downloaded data files.
- Even a small improve during the enter ends in a totally distinct hash as a result of avalanche result.
When the Original input was more than two 512-little bit blocks lengthy, the A, B,C and D outputs that may have in any other case formed the hash are as a substitute employed as initialization vectors with the third block.
A collision happens when two unique inputs deliver the same hash output, compromising the algorithm’s integrity. That is a vital situation for stability-delicate applications, which include digital signatures, file integrity examining, and certification technology, where the uniqueness from the hash is important.
A greatly utilized cryptographic hash purpose that makes a 128-little bit hash benefit, typically expressed being a 32-character hexadecimal variety. Employed for verifying facts integrity but has become viewed as cryptographically damaged as a consequence of vulnerabilities.
In summary, MD5 can be a broadly-employed cryptographic hash perform that converts input data into a hard and fast-sized output or digest that could be employed for safety and verification reasons.
MD5, or Message-Digest Algorithm 5, is usually a cryptographic hash purpose that generates a 128-bit hash value, normally often called a “concept digest.” It was designed by Ronald Rivest in 1991 and is particularly principally accustomed to verify details integrity by manufacturing a set-length hash from enter info of any size.
Items modify At the beginning of spherical two. Its 1st operation, the 17th General, begins with a special perform. The F function is changed via the G functionality, that may be employed for operations 17 via 32. The G perform is as follows:
Prioritize Techniques: Prioritize the migration of essential devices and those that deal with sensitive info. These must be the main to changeover to safer authentication methods.
Following the shift has long been created, the result of every one of website these calculations is added to the worth for initialization vector B. At first, it’s 89abcdef, but it really alterations in subsequent operations.
That’s why this second usage is considerably less and fewer Recurrent, even if it’s nevertheless utilised in certain code mainly because it’s not that easy to switch to another algorithm.
Comments on “Indicators on what is md5's application You Should Know”